Summary

House Concurrent Resolution 116, sponsored by Representative Ritchie, commends Louisiana State University student Tyler Crosby for his receipt of the highly prestigious Barry M. Goldwater Scholarship. The resolution highlights Crosby's impressive academic journey, noting his dedication as a biological engineering junior and his involvement in various academic and extracurricular activities, including the LSU China Initiative and his role as webmaster for the LSU Biological Engineering Student Organization. It also emphasizes his aspirations to pursue both a Doctor of Medicine and Doctor of Philosophy degrees, focusing on clinical research and genetic therapies for diseases.
